Responsibilities
Administer defined benefit and defined contribution plans.
Pro-actively identify and collaboratively develop and manage projects that will improve service to our participants and streamline current processes.
Develop process and plan documentation and communication materials for these plans, working in collaboration with colleagues and external vendors.
Work with employees and vendors to ensure accurate and timely responses to all outstanding plan/participant issues.
Manage open items lists and project plans, executing and managing activities with vendors bringing projects to timely closure.
Stay abreast of laws, regulations and compliance requirements including IRS/DOL regulations for a multi-state employer.
Review, interpret and collaboratively formulate programmatic recommendations.
Collaboratively evaluate existing plans and programs through research, surveys, and analysis of benefit trends and/or vendor management to ensure plans are competitive and current.
Provide data support for the annual plan census and cyclical plan activities.
Support Finance team and bring technical knowledge to the preparation of Forms 5500 and other government fillings, plan document updates, preparation of amendments, etc.
Create educational, analytical, and strategic presentations for various audiences including senior management, business colleagues, and plan participants.
Participate in supporting analysis for other benefit programs; provide project support and management as needed in any area of benefits.
Assume additional responsibilities as requested.
This role requires 60% in office presence; remote work is permissible 40% of the time.
